The murder of Meredith Kercher, a British exchange student, in Perugia, Italy, on November 1, 2007, garnered international attention. Amanda Knox, an American student studying in Perugia, became a central figure in the case.

Knox’s involvement began when she was initially arrested as a suspect in Kercher’s murder, along with her then-boyfriend, Raffaele Sollecito, and Rudy Guede, an Ivorian immigrant. The prosecution alleged that Knox and Sollecito had killed Kercher in a drug-fueled sexual assault, while Guede was an accomplice.

Knox’s trial was highly publicized and controversial. The prosecution presented evidence including DNA found at the crime scene and on Knox’s clothing, as well as witness testimony placing her at the scene of the murder. However, Knox maintained her innocence throughout the trial, claiming that she was not present at the time of the murder and that the DNA evidence had been contaminated.

In 2009, Knox and Sollecito were convicted of murder and sentenced to 26 and 25 years in prison, respectively. However, their convictions were overturned on appeal in 2011, and they were acquitted of all charges. Guede was convicted of murder in a separate trial and sentenced to 16 years in prison.

The Unique Aspects of the Italian Justice System

The Italian justice system is based on a civil law system, which differs from the common law systems found in many other countries. In a civil law system, judges are responsible for both finding the facts of a case and applying the law to those facts. This differs from common law systems, where juries are responsible for finding the facts and judges are responsible for applying the law.

The Italian justice system is also known for its slow pace. Cases can take years to be resolved, and there is often a significant backlog of cases waiting to be heard. This can lead to delays in justice for victims and their families.
